aboutsummaryrefslogtreecommitdiffstats
path: root/travis/test
diff options
context:
space:
mode:
authorCyrill Gorcunov <gorcunov@gmail.com>2020-08-25 14:40:10 +0300
committerCyrill Gorcunov <gorcunov@gmail.com>2020-08-25 16:36:10 +0300
commit7f3cfafbd991176012f21d6446dbf96e93bbbfd7 (patch)
treea871c1a11b3baa32ff493e8dc31c38bb815cdd94 /travis/test
parent63ccbf4f5fed724037c48de1a767cfa7290fdf19 (diff)
downloadnasm-7f3cfafbd991176012f21d6446dbf96e93bbbfd7.tar.gz
nasm-7f3cfafbd991176012f21d6446dbf96e93bbbfd7.tar.xz
nasm-7f3cfafbd991176012f21d6446dbf96e93bbbfd7.zip
travis: add br3392275
Signed-off-by: Cyrill Gorcunov <gorcunov@gmail.com>
Diffstat (limited to 'travis/test')
-rw-r--r--travis/test/br3392275.asm10
-rw-r--r--travis/test/br3392275.bin.t1
-rw-r--r--travis/test/br3392275.json12
3 files changed, 23 insertions, 0 deletions
diff --git a/travis/test/br3392275.asm b/travis/test/br3392275.asm
new file mode 100644
index 00000000..c37343d4
--- /dev/null
+++ b/travis/test/br3392275.asm
@@ -0,0 +1,10 @@
+ bits 32
+
+ blendvpd xmm2,xmm1,xmm0
+ blendvpd xmm2,xmm1
+ blendvps xmm2,xmm1,xmm0
+ blendvps xmm2,xmm1
+ pblendvb xmm2,xmm1,xmm0
+ pblendvb xmm2,xmm1
+ sha256rnds2 xmm2,xmm1,xmm0
+ sha256rnds2 xmm2,xmm1
diff --git a/travis/test/br3392275.bin.t b/travis/test/br3392275.bin.t
new file mode 100644
index 00000000..9f704492
--- /dev/null
+++ b/travis/test/br3392275.bin.t
@@ -0,0 +1 @@
+f8f8f8f8f8f888 \ No newline at end of file
diff --git a/travis/test/br3392275.json b/travis/test/br3392275.json
new file mode 100644
index 00000000..3d48812d
--- /dev/null
+++ b/travis/test/br3392275.json
@@ -0,0 +1,12 @@
+[
+ {
+ "id": "br3392275",
+ "description": "Do not require xmm0 to be explicitly declared when implicit",
+ "format": "bin",
+ "source": "br3392275.asm",
+ "option": "-Ox",
+ "target": [
+ { "output": "br3392275.bin" }
+ ]
+ }
+]